Pure aluminum has actually limited applications, so it is frequently combined with various other components, such as silicon, magnesium, and manganese to create alloys.


(AA), based in North America, has actually developed specifications that control light weight aluminum alloys' make-up, residential or commercial properties, and classification. There are two kinds of light weight aluminum alloys wrought and cast.

Cast aluminum alloys are made by melting pure aluminum and combining it with other steels while in liquid form. The mix is put right into a sand, pass away, or investment mold and mildew.

Wrought light weight aluminum alloys likewise begin by incorporating liquified aluminum with other metals. As opposed to cast alloys, nonetheless, they are formed into their final shape with procedures such as extrusion, rolling, and flexing after the metal has strengthened right into billets or ingots.


There are lots of small distinctions in between wrought and cast aluminum alloys, such as that cast alloys can include much more substantial quantities of various other steels than functioned alloys. The most notable distinction in between these alloys is the manufacture process via which they will go to deliver the final product. Apart from some surface area treatments, cast alloys will leave their mold and mildew in virtually the specific solid type preferred, whereas wrought alloys will undertake a number of alterations while in their strong state

Pass away casting is the name offered to the procedure of producing complex steel elements through usage of molds of the part, likewise understood as dies. It generates more parts than any type of various other process, with a high level of accuracy and repeatability. There are 3 sub-processes that fall under the category of die spreading: gravity die spreading (or permanent mold and mildew casting), low-pressure die spreading and high-pressure die casting.

After the purity of the alloy is tested, passes away are created - Foundry. To prepare the passes away for spreading, it is vital that the dies are tidy, so that no residue from previous manufacturings remain.


The pure steel, additionally understood as ingot, is included to the furnace and maintained at the molten temperature level of the metal, which is then transferred to the shot chamber and infused into the die. The pressure is after that preserved as the steel strengthens. Once the steel strengthens, the cooling process begins.


The thicker the wall of the part, the longer the cooling time as a result of the quantity of indoor metal that additionally requires to cool down. After the part is fully cooled down, the die cuts in half open and an ejection device pushes the component out. Complying with the ejection, the die is shut for the following injection cycle.

The flash is the extra material that is cast during the process. This should be trimmed off utilizing a trim tool to leave just the primary element. Deburring eliminates the smaller pieces, called burrs, after the cutting procedure. The element is polished, or burnished, to give it a smooth finish.


Today, leading suppliers utilize x-ray testing to see the whole interior of elements without cutting right into them. To get to the finished product, there are 3 main alloys used as die spreading material to select from: zinc, aluminum and magnesium.


Zinc is one of the most used alloys for die casting due to its reduced cost of raw materials. Its deterioration resistance additionally enables the components to be long enduring, and it is one of the extra castable alloys due to its lower melting point.
